To give you a better idea of what the 21 points of skill are, we have divided them into seven categories:
1. Cognitive Skills
The cognitive skills category includes competencies such as critical thinking, problem-solving, memory, logic, and decision making. These abilities are crucial in both personal and professional settings as they allow individuals to handle complex issues and make informed judgments.
2. Creative Skills
Creative skills are inherent in the process of generating new ideas, concepts or solutions. They include imagination, original thinking, intuitive abilities, and artistic and musical talents.
3. Interpersonal Skills
Interpersonal skills refer to the ability to interact and communicate effectively with others. It includes verbal and non-verbal communication, active listening, empathy, and building relationships.
4. Emotional Intelligence
Emotional intelligence covers the skill set required to understand and manage one's own emotions and those of others around them. It includes self-awareness, empathy, self-regulation, social skills, and motivation.
5. Practical Skills
Practical skills are more associated with professional life, and they cover the skills needed to perform specific tasks or duties. It includes technical skills, problem-solving skills, time management, and organizational skills.
6. Leadership
Leadership is the ability to inspire, motivate, and influence others to achieve a common goal. It includes skills such as vision, empathy, strategic thinking, decision-making, accountability, and effective delegation.
7. Financial Acumen
The financial acumen category is also associated with professional life, and it covers skills required in managing finances, budgets and investment strategies. It includes skills such as financial forecasting, analysis, and decision-making.
